3 odd things I learned from reading my X feed this morning:
1) After the Chicago debacle, Rudy pleaded with the staff to have the offense in front of the Wolves bench in the second half (I never knew that was something the visiting team gets to choose) to avoid 4th quarter collapses. We're 3-0 on the road since that change!
2) Ant says he was very close to not playing last night because of the knee, but he decided to go at the last moment...and he puts up 41!
3) I wish I had pulled the trigger on the 1000 to 1 prop bet that Mike Conley would have 3 or more blocked shots. He's turning into one of the best rim protectors in the Association
